How To Become A Successful Freelance Digital Artist

If you want to showcase your creative skills and earn money on the side, you might as well consider a freelance gig as a digital artist. According to Payscale, freelance graphic designers with one to four years’ experience in Kenya could earn up to KSh 470,000. Meanwhile, independent digital artists could earn even more through overseas clients.
As much as it is one of the most lucrative online gigs for Kenyans, freelancing as a digital artist requires a great deal of investment in terms of time and skills. What’s more, you will also find yourself competing against other more experienced freelancers.
Success doesn’t come easily to digital creatives, but there are ways you make it happen and build a stable career as a freelancer. Take a look at these tips:
- Focus on a niche
What are you good at? Do you have any experience creating commercial art for the purpose of marketing and advertising? Are you willing to accept commissions from individuals? When getting started as a digital artist, you need to work with what you are familiar with. It’s a great way to acquire experience and grow your network before you can venture into other markets or areas.
- Develop a social media presence
Platforms like UpWork and Fiverr are ideal if you are looking for work. However, most clients require more than a well-written resume before they can hire you. They want to look at your social media profiles in order to get a better idea of what you can provide. With that being said, you might want to set up a professional page on social platforms like Instagram, Behance, and Facebook and upload your best work there. This adds to your credibility and helps promote your creative services.
- Become a part of a community
Artists are not always competitive. At most times, they prop each other up and discuss opportunities together. Some may even collaborate on a project or refer clients to each other. In any case, you need to be open and eager to build professional relationships. You can start by joining online artists’ groups and providing resources to beginners in the freelancing world. You need other people as much as need your skills, so it’s important to always be ready to connect.
- Be adaptive
As the tech landscape continues to evolve, it’s important that you acquire marketable skills as a freelance digital artist. Not only do you need to learn fixing issues such as a Photoshop scratch disk full error, but you should also keep tabs on new drawing and painting tools as well as certain aesthetic trends. You want your art to be marketable, so make sure to focus on what your market wants and use that as a reference point.
- Be true to your style
As much as you want to conform to current trends, you still need to enrich your style. Your identity as an artist hinges on your output. You are basically your own brand, so make sure to develop your own voice. Chances are, you will be able to set your own trends.
With these tips in mind, you can build a solid foundation as a freelance digital artist, accomplish your goals, and make an impact in the lives of individuals and organizations who need creative support.
